    • PDF Shaper 15.6 by Razvan Serea PDF Shaper is a set of feature-rich PDF software that makes it simple to split, merge, watermark, sign, optimize, convert, encrypt and decrypt your PDF documents, also delete and move pages, extract text and images. The program is optimized for low CPU resource usage and operates in batch mode, allowing users to process multiple PDF files while doing other work on their computers. PDF Shaper is available in three editions - Free, Premium and Ultimate. Compare and pick edition which is suitable for you. Compatible with Windows 7, 8, 10, 11. Features: Convert PDFs to Word, text, or image files (and vice versa) Merge, split, and watermark documents with precision Insert, move, delete, rotate and crop pages/ranges Rename and organize PDF collections efficiently Encrypt with advanced AES password protection Apply multiple digital signatures for documents Extract text, images, or complete pages from any PDF Benefits: Easy-to-use, intuitive user interface Low CPU resource usage during any process, including conversion Free for personal use and for any non-commercial organization Supports Unicode characters Supports batch processing for any operation Small installation size PDF Shaper 15.6 changelog: Improved overall program performance. Improved image rendering in all tools. Improved XMP information extraction. Improved compatibility with ARM64 systems. Improved DOC to PDF conversion: Improved support for font files. Improved support for picture cropping. Improved support for list formatting. Improved support for text line spacing.
